Output ddb24f25ceec52f199c7c6565a69825e569ca3fe7aee1ece4967f4350a6a3927:16

value
312875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f436693d305a636aa5751bb543df1c63ea6f3f3 OP_EQUAL
address
3K8KjGMofzoT2aaE9HXAcsLS5DKQ2n7vCb
transaction
ddb24f25ceec52f199c7c6565a69825e569ca3fe7aee1ece4967f4350a6a3927
spent
true